Joey Logano wins NASCAR Nationwide race in Phoenix

Share

AVONDALE, Ariz. -- Joey Logano held off Brian Vickers in a two-lap shootout to win the NASCAR Nationwide Series race Saturday at Phoenix International Raceway.

The two were battling for the lead with two laps left in the scheduled 200 laps of the Great Clips 200 when Elliott Sadler, who is battling Ricky Stenhouse Jr. for the Nationwide title, crashed along with Cole Whitt and Brendan Gaughan.

That set up the two-lap “green-white-checkered” finish won by Logano, whose Toyota started on the pole and was dominant all day. Logano led a race-high 168 laps.

Advertisement

Stenhouse, the reigning Nationwide champion, finished third and Kyle Busch was fourth.

Sadler finished 22nd after his crash and fell 20 points behind Stenhouse for the lead in this year’s Nationwide title standings with one race remaining. They had started the race tied for the series lead.

Danica Patrick finished 10th in her Chevrolet after starting 14th and climbing as high as sixth in the latter half of the race.
